Allen Franklin Fisher 1876–1942 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 7 DEC 1876

Birth Location: Tennessee, USA

Death Date: 10 JUL 1942

Death Location: Pikeville, Bledsoe, Tennessee, USA

Father: William Fisher

Mother: Sophronia McDowell

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

Allen Franklin Fisher was born in 1876 in Tennessee, USA, the child of William Dexton Fisher And Sophronia Adcock Mcdowell. Allen Franklin Fisher passed away in 1942 in Pikeville, Bledsoe, Tennessee, USA.
